Prices delayed by at least 15 minutes | Print


Valero Energy Corp (VLO)

Common Stock
Sell: $164.17|Buy: $166.41|Change: 1.33 (-0.80%)

This share can be held in a Dealing accountISALifetime ISAJISASIPP